Работа с сервисом ВЧАСНО EDI (Vchasno.ua)

13.08.20

Интеграция - WEB-интеграция

Добавление к конфигурации + внешняя обработка. Позволяет принимать, отслеживать состояние заказа и создавать свои документы для работы с EDI Вчасно в 1С. Большинство методов универсальные - все-таки "почти" стандарт от COMMARCH EDI.

Скачать файл

ВНИМАНИЕ: Файлы из Базы знаний - это исходный код разработки. Это примеры решения задач, шаблоны, заготовки, "строительные материалы" для учетной системы. Файлы ориентированы на специалистов 1С, которые могут разобраться в коде и оптимизировать программу для запуска в базе данных. Гарантии работоспособности нет. Возврата нет. Технической поддержки нет.

Наименование По подписке [?] Купить один файл
Работа с сервисом ВЧАСНО EDI (Vchasno.ua):
.epf 93,24Kb
9
9 Скачать (1 SM) Купить за 1 850 руб.

За основу проекта взяты наработки сервиса «Вчасно», частично использован вариант интерфейса для работы с Comarch EDI и модифицированный алгоритм обработки XML.

Представлено дополнение для УТП 1.2.57.1. (Изменено 13/08/2020)

Что не устраивало в обработках от «Вчасно»  (их уже две версии, последняя от 10/08/2020, а предыдущая,скорее всего, заброшена):

- все настройки (интерфейса и системы обмена) хранятся индивидуально для каждого пользователя. Т.е. кто-то кого-то подменяет – вводим заново параметры доступа API/FTP и т.д.;

- параметры входящего документа из системы Вчасно (ID, DEAl_Id, GLN, Товары(!) и т.д.) хранятся в РегистреСведений для документа типа Счет/Заказ. Просмотреть – неудобно. Отредактировать – тем более и не пользователю. Желающие могут открыть форму «ФормаСопоставленияДанных» оригинальной обработки;

- сделаны не все документы (прайс-лист, например);

- данные вносятся не всегда корректно (например, вместо номера и даты НН передается параметры из РН);

- много не нужного старого кода и лишних форм;

- «странности» при обмене, требующие ручной доработки кода. Примеры.

1. Заказчик выбрал старый код товара, уже не выпускающийся. Меняем на новый. Подтверждение, отгрузка, серийные номера ушли и приняты с новым кодом, а реализация должна быть только со старым)

2. Количество товара в подтверждении и серийных номерах может быть только целым.

3. Есть чувствительность к порядку следования полей в записи.

4. Обязателен порядок товара из заказа с добавлением «отказов» в специальном формате.

 

Что сделано.

  1. Созданы полноценные документы ORDER, DESADV, DELNOTES, PriCat, RetIn, RecAdv и выстроена их иерархия.
  2. GLN-параметры хранятся в справочниках.
  3. Генерация XML выведена в обыкновенную печатную форму.
  4. Настройки сервиса глобальны и хранятся в справочнике.
  5. Соответствие товара Покупатель-Продавец ведется через «Номенклатуру Контрагента».
  6. Реализован импорт из XML практически любого формата.
  7. Ведомость для ввода серийных номеров отправляется на склад (e-mail), там заполняется и возвращается в офис, где по нажатию кнопки читаются из файла. Проверка номера РН присутствует – чужое не введется.
  8. Реализовано наложение ЭЦП на накладную

Что сделано частично.

  1. Прием подтверждений не особо удобен: система помечает "как новые" только заказы. Все остальное - сами проверяйте. При выгрузке накладной в DESADVе сохраняется ID-документа, возвращаемый в ответе сервера. При получении подтверждения о приемке он становится "отрицательным" (добавляется знак "-"). При этом налоговые накладные дополнительно раскрашиваются, как признак невозможности редактирования.

Что не сделано

  1. Отказ от заказа не сделан. Причина – необходимость создания в 1С Заказа с 0 количеством товара. Не пустой он не сохранится. Пустой он и не нужен. Через WEB-форму.

Особенности.

  1. Синонимы имен реквизитов созданных документов и их табличных частей необходимы для однозначного соответствия с полями в XML. Совпало – заполняем (при импорте) или выводим (при экспорте).
  2. Не все поля доступны для редактирования вручную. Дабы избежать проблем в обычном режиме. Не очень удобно при нестандартной ситуации.

ВЧАСНО EDI Vchasno Украина

См. также

WEB-интеграция Анализ продаж Системный администратор Программист Пользователь Платформа 1С v8.3 1С:ERP Управление предприятием 2 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х Управленческий учет Платные (руб)

Модуль "Подсистема интеграции AmoCRM с 1С" позволяет обеспечить единое информационное пространство, в котором пользователи могут эффективно управлять клиентской базой, следить за статусами сделок и поддерживать актуальность данных как в AmoCRM, так и в 1С.

60000 руб.

07.05.2019    36502    72    45    

31

WEB-интеграция Администрирование веб-серверов Платные (руб)

Веб-портал обеспечивает удобный доступ к конфигурации 1С:ITIL(ИТИЛ), 1С:ITILIUM, Управление IT-отделом 8 через интернет с любого устройства посредством браузера, увеличивая эффективность работы пользователей и снижая нагрузку на сервер. Быстрая инсталляция портала за пару часов, удобный и интуитивно понятный интерфейс и безопасность данных помогут упростить работу с порталом и ускорить выполнение бизнес-процессов компании.

128000 руб.

19.12.2023    5545    4    0    

12

Сайты и интернет-магазины WEB-интеграция Системный администратор Программист Пользователь Платформа 1С v8.3 1C:Бухгалтерия 1С:Управление торговлей 11 Автомобили, автосервисы Россия Управленческий учет Платные (руб)

Интеграционный модуль обмена между конфигурацией Альфа Авто 5 и Альфа Авто 6 и порталом AUTOCRM. Данный модуль универсален. Позволяет работать с несколькими обменами AUTOCRM разных брендов в одной информационной базе в ручном и автоматическом режиме.

36000 руб.

03.08.2020    20096    26    24    

22

WEB-интеграция Программист Бизнес-аналитик Платформа 1С v8.3 1С:ERP Управление предприятием 2 1С:Бухгалтерия 3.0 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х 1С:Управление нашей фирмой 3.0 1С:Розница 3.0 Оптовая торговля, дистрибуция, логистика ИТ-компания Платные (руб)

Модуль "Экспортер" — это расширение для 1С, предназначенное для автоматизации процессов выгрузки данных. Оно позволяет эффективно извлекать, преобразовывать и передавать данные из систем 1С в интеграционную платформу Spot2D. Подсистема упрощает настройку, снижает количество ручных операций и обеспечивает удобный контроль данных.

14400 руб.

20.12.2024    1762    10    2    

13

WEB-интеграция Программист Руководитель проекта Платформа 1С v8.3 1C:Бухгалтерия 1С:Франчайзи, автоматизация бизнеса Платные (руб)

Расширение значительно упрощает написание API на 1С. Веб программисты получают простой и понятный доступ к 1С. Описание API создаётся автоматически и представляется в виде удобном как для человека, так и для программной обработки.

24000 руб.

27.09.2024    6484    4    2    

8

Сайты и интернет-магазины Интеграция WEB-интеграция Платформа 1С v8.3 1C:Бухгалтерия Управленческий учет Платные (руб)

Решение осуществляет синхронизацию задач Битрикс24 и 1С, что позволяет в одной системе ставить задачи, контролировать выполнение всего пула задач с группировкой по ответственным и проектам, формировать управленческие отчеты по работе сотрудников (загрузка, просроченные задачи), уведомлять сотрудников о ходе выполнения задач посредством чат-бот Telegram

7200 руб.

04.05.2021    21692    13    19    

19
Комментарии
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
1. Sykoku 102 19.11.19 14:00 Сейчас в теме
Внесены изменения в Pricat.
Оформлено внешней формы.

Изменена формы XML для Вчасно добавлена XLS-форма для рАзетки.

Добавлено внесение в документ рекомендованых цен на основе цен "АТТ"
Прикрепленные файлы:
Pricat.epf
AlexDiablo; +1 Ответить
2. Sykoku 102 19.11.19 14:02 Сейчас в теме
Добавлен экспорт прайса во Вчасно

Ответ сервиса - код 200 + список товаров в JSON'е.
Прикрепленные файлы:
Обмін_EDI_УТП_УПП (20190523 SSW) V.49.epf
3. Sykoku 102 20.11.19 19:46 Сейчас в теме
Оказалось, что Вчасно не умеют раскодировать base64 больше 64 кБ.
XML передается plain/text

Добавляется Реквизит "ПередаватьXML" в справочник EDI_API.


Для возможности выгрузки из РН списка товаров для внесения серийных номеров через сайт "Вчасно" изменен порядок сортировки Товаров в процедуре ПечатьРозетки(). Кусок кода - ниже.

Изменения в РасходнойНакладной.МодульОбъекта
Прикрепленные файлы:
Обмін_EDI_УТП_УПП (2019_11_20 SSW) V.50.epf
4. Sykoku 102 26.12.19 16:22 Сейчас в теме
Изменена обработка и пример конфигурации.

1. В документе PRICAT есть возможность добавить наценку/скидку и создать на его основании документ "УсловияПоставкиПоДоговарамКонтрагента". Внимание! Правильно выбирайте договор Контрагента!

2. В настройках экспорта Справочника "EDI" появилась возможность управления отправляемыми полями кодов поставшика и их содержимым.

3.Формирование формы для внесения внутренних штрихкодов рАзетки (из РеализацииТоваровУслуг) теперь позволяет сортировать и согласно ЗаказуПоставщика.

4. Изменены процедуры выгрузки в API и разбор ответов.

5. Добавлен выбор режима выгрузки - plain / base64
5. Sykoku 102 27.12.19 16:50 Сейчас в теме
Забыл исправить - прайс выгружается автоматом. Ответ - 200 + JSON загруженного.
6. Sykoku 102 05.08.20 18:48 Сейчас в теме
Подключение подписей MeDoc

1.У "АЦСК Україна" нет CMP-сервера, снимаем галочку
2. Импортируем сертификаты ключей пользователей с сайта https://uakey.com.ua/ - вводите ЭДРПОУ
3. Импортируем корневые сертификаты АСЦК с сайта https://uakey.com.ua/page/about
4.Сохраняем файл https://ca.informjust.ua/download/Soft/CACertificates.p7b в каталог сертификатов и СВС (C:\My Certificates and CRLs 13\)

После этого процедура

SetPrivateKeyFile вернет "THRUE"
7. Sykoku 102 05.08.20 18:52 Сейчас в теме
Подключение ключей ПРИВАТа.

У них для ТОВ в одном файле jks сразу два ключа.

Обычно выбирается печать. Для управления подпись/печать надо правильно указывать 4-й параметр при вызове

EUTaxService.SetPrivateKeyFile(?(ТипКлюча=4,1,ТипКлюча), ФайлКлюча, ПарольКлюча, ?(ТипКлюча=3,Ложь, Истина));
8. Sykoku 102 06.08.20 10:37 Сейчас в теме
Ключи ПРИВАТа.

Есть еще возможность их переконвертировать в другой формат.

в МеДок
- https://elbuh.com.ua/news/118-kak-konvertirovat-klyuchi-privat-banka-v-m-e-doc.html

в Key-6.dat
- https://uakey.com.ua/faq/jak-perekonvertuvati-kljuch-kepecp-dlja-portalu-data
9. Sykoku 102 07.08.20 14:53 Сейчас в теме
Добавились функция подписи.

Пришлось извращаться: отправляемое на сервер и загруженное с него, как "оригинал", "слегка" отличаются. Поэтому подпись, наложенная на только что отправленное не была валидной.

Обработка сыровата, но работает.
Прикрепленные файлы:
Обмін_EDI_УТП_УПП (2020_08_05 SSW) V.59.epf
10. Sykoku 102 03.03.21 18:15 Сейчас в теме
Улучшения, добавления, фильтр входящих - только незавершенные сделки...
Прикрепленные файлы:
Обмін_EDI_УТП_УПП (2020_08_05 SSW) V.63.epf
AlexDiablo; +1 Ответить
11. DiegoLidabo 12 03.07.22 17:33 Сейчас в теме
Можете выложить конфигурацию?
Оставьте свое сообщение